Youths in Karingarapully died from electric trap set for wild boars, land owner buried bodies

by Janam Web Desk
Sep 27, 2023, 12:11 pm IST
in Kerala

Palakkadu: The owner of the land has confessed to burying two youths, whose body parts were found in a paddy field near Palneeri Colony in Karingarapully. Police arrested the accused owner of the land, Anand Kumar, over the incident. Further interrogation uncovered that the youths tragically lost their lives in an electric trap set for wild boars, prompting the landowner to bury their bodies in a state of panic.

The Kasaba Police had registered a case against Satheesh, Shijith, and their friends Abhin and Ajith in connection with an altercation with a gang in Venoli last Sunday night. Subsequently, the four individuals went into hiding, taking refuge at Satheesh’s relative’s residence in Karingarapully. On Monday morning, fearing that the police had reached the relative’s house to apprehend them, they fled into the fields.

Abhin and Ajith ran in one direction, and Satheesh and Shijith ran in another direction. Though Abhin and Ajith reached Venoli later, they couldn’t find the other two. When their calls went unanswered, the duo decided to approach Kasaba police station and lodge a missing complaint.

During the course of their search, the police team noticed that the soil in a nearby paddy field appeared to have been disturbed. The bodies are scheduled to be exhumed this morning and sent for post-mortem examination. The police have indicated that further details will become available following the autopsy.
